I wonder whether it > will recognise one of these ? > http://www.amazon.co.uk/gp/aw/d/B00O0U37HO?vs=1 As a first start you could try software players. I seem to recall that phiillipe (the author) has used foobar2000 as a UPNP renderer - I haven't (apart from a very brief check), but foobar normally runs on Windows and is happy enough running under wine on linux. A UPnP plugin is available for it.
I also use a UPnP renderer on my laptop sometimes, called upmpdcli (which employs mpd as its audio device). I got it working briefly early on with sq2u but it's not a mainstream solution for me since I can use the original squeezelite instead. If you want to know if that might work I could test it again.
